Buchwald–Hartwig versus Microwave-Assisted Amination of Chloroquinolines: En Route to the Pyoverdin Chromophore
2020
The reaction of 2-chloro-6,7-dimethoxy-3-nitroquinoline with a series of amines and aminoalkanoates under basic microwave-mediated conditions and under Buchwald–Hartwig amination conditions is reported. The microwave irradiation favored the reaction with amines, resulting in yields of up to 80%, whereas amino acid functionalization gave yields comparable to those of Buchwald–Hartwig amination. tert-Butyl (2R)-4-[(6,7-dimethoxy-3-nitroquinolin-2-yl)amino]-2-hydroxybutanoate was successfully cyclized to the pyoverdin chromophore, a subunit of siderophores.
